What questions should I ask before hiring a dui / dwi attorney?
Before hiring a dui / dwi attorney, ask these essential questions: How many years have you practiced dui / dwi law specifically? How many cases similar to mine have you handled, and what were the outcomes? Will you personally handle my case or delegate it to associates or paralegals? What is your fee structure, and what total costs should I anticipate? How will you keep me informed about case progress, and how quickly do you respond to client communications? What is your assessment of my case strengths and weaknesses? What is the likely timeline for resolution? Are you board certified or have any specialty certifications? What is your trial experience if my case cannot be settled? Can you provide references from past clients with similar cases? The answers to these questions will help you evaluate both competence and compatibility, which are equally important in choosing the right attorney for your situation.
How much does a dui / dwi attorney cost?
The cost of a dui / dwi attorney varies based on case complexity, attorney experience, geographic location, and billing method. Hourly rates typically range from $200 to $500 per hour. Some attorneys offer flat fee arrangements ranging from $2,500-$10,000 for straightforward matters. Retainer fees typically range from $3,000-$10,000. Major metropolitan areas command higher rates than rural areas. Attorney experience significantly impacts pricing, with seasoned specialists charging more than general practitioners. Always get a detailed written fee agreement before hiring an attorney, and ask about all potential costs including filing fees, expert witnesses, and other expenses that may arise during your case.
